
Valmet has signed a Value-Added Reseller (VAR) partnership with Solidus Assyst to deliver the Valmet DNA Distributed Control System (DCS) and Valmet DNA Machine Monitoring to process industries, excluding the pulp and paper industry, in Greece and Cyprus. This partnership combines Solidus Assyst’s strong expertise in engineering and delivering HIMA-based safety systems with the robust and innovative capabilities of Valmet DNA DCS.
Together, the companies will strengthen Valmet’s automation footprint in the region and offer advanced automation solutions across a wide range of industries. For the energy industry projects, Valmet will act as the main contractor, with Solidus Assyst serving as a supplier for engineering and start-up services in projects executed in Greece and Cyprus.
